Particle aggregates formed during furfuryl methacrylate plasma polymerization affect human mesenchymal stem cell

Summary

Plasma polymerized Furfuryl Methacrylate (ppFMA) thin films support human mesenchymal stem cell (hMSC) expansion. Uniform ppFMA surfaces promote hMSC attachment and growth, unlike those with particle aggregates.
